将文件作为word文档下载到闪亮的应用程序中

将文件作为word文档下载到闪亮的应用程序中,r,shiny,R,Shiny,是否可以通过shinnyapp下载空word文档 ui <- fluidPage( downloadButton("downloadData", "Download") ) server <- function(input, output) { # Our dataset data <- mtcars output$downloadData <- downloadHandler( filename = f

是否可以通过
shinny
app下载空word文档

ui <- fluidPage(
  downloadButton("downloadData", "Download")
)

server <- function(input, output) {
  # Our dataset
  data <- mtcars

  output$downloadData <- downloadHandler(
    filename = function() {
      paste("data-", Sys.Date(), ".csv", sep="")
    },
    content = function(file) {
      write.csv(data, file)
    }
  )
}

shinyApp(ui, server)

ui-Create
empty.docx
yourself(使用pandoc/knitr或Word或类似工具编程),将其包含在软件包中,然后返回。然而,您说的是“word文档”,但您的示例显示的是CSV。是哪一个?.doc但我留下了csv示例你的
内容
部分是否可以改为
文件.copy(“path/to/premade/empty.doc”,file)
?内容=函数(path/to/premade/empty.doc,file))?否。
内容=函数(file)文件.copy(“path/to/premade/empty.doc”,file)